zaitcev wrote: Good grief, Eddie, that stall horn in turns sounds really worrysome. How close are you to the accelerated stall? Thought about installing an AoA indicator?
The stall horn is a Cessna part and not adjustable.
If you look at the airspeed indicator when the horn sounds, I'm often 15k+ above stall speed. Makes it annoying, but only dangerous if it led me to ignore it. Which I kinda do, I guess.
Re:AOA indicator...I'm trying to keep things simple, and approaching at about 55k when the full flap stall speed is 39k really gives me plenty of margin. |
